Journalists globally face growing threats and they are also increasing in Europe.

The European Centre for Press and Media Freedom’s conference Defending Journalists under Threat takes place on 5th October 2017 at Leipzig School of Media in Germany.

Journalists who are under threat from a range of different pressures will give their testimony and present case studies. Organisations that offer refuge and solidarity will discuss the practical implications of how best to help them. And political and legal experts discuss the policy and regulatory changes that will safeguard journalists and their sources under threat, with a special focus on protection for whistleblowers.

Speakers and participants from all over Europe and a variety of backgrounds will contribute to the discussions.

Dr Lutz Kinkel

Managing Director, European Centre for Press and Media Freedom
Lutz Kinkel represents and manages the ECPMF. Lutz worked in German press for more than 20 years, giving special focus to the areas of politics and media.
